Character Traits of a Leader: Sense of Humor



A leader has got to have a sense of humor. A leader cannot go around stoic, with a frown, or serious all the time. This does not work for anyone, it is bad. It is bad for the leader as an individual. It is bad for the leader as a leader.

Your followers, those you lead expect you to have a sense of humor. That's because there will times and situations that you will have no control over and you are just going to have to laugh at it. You are going to have to chuckle, you are going to have to laugh right along with them.

Speaking of laughing with them. As a leader, never laugh at them, don't belittle them, don't be mean, don't do or say anything at their expense. Don't bad mouth individuals whether they are present or not. Do not bad mouth anyone who is not present because they cannot defend themselves. Doing so makes you a BULLY!

Whatever you do, do not laugh at people because I guarantee just like you are laughing at somebody that person is laughing at YOU!
